A circuit is built based on this circuit diagram. What is the equivalent resistance of the circuit?

A. 0.61
B. 1.6
C. 7.5
D. 18

The three resistors are connected to the same points of the circuit, so they are in parallel configuration. The equivalent resistance of 3 resistors in parallel is given by:

(1)/(R_(eq))= (1)/(R_1)+ (1)/(R_2)+ (1)/(R_3)
If we plug the values of the resistances into the formula, we find

(1)/(R_(eq))= (1)/(3.0 \Omega)+ (1)/(6.0 \Omega)+ (1)/(9.0 \Omega)= (6+3+2)/(18.0 \Omega) = (11)/(18.0 \Omega)
From which we find the equivalent resistance:

R_(eq) = (18.0)/(11) \Omega =1.6 \Omega

So, the correct answer is B.
